Spaces:
Sleeping
Sleeping
Update app.py
Browse files
app.py
CHANGED
|
@@ -174,8 +174,10 @@ with gr.Blocks() as demo:
|
|
| 174 |
clear.click(clear_chat, None, chatbot, queue=False)
|
| 175 |
|
| 176 |
upload_btn.upload(upload_json, upload_btn, [upload_status, category])
|
| 177 |
-
|
| 178 |
-
|
|
|
|
|
|
|
| 179 |
|
| 180 |
# -----------------------------
|
| 181 |
# Startup log
|
|
|
|
| 174 |
clear.click(clear_chat, None, chatbot, queue=False)
|
| 175 |
|
| 176 |
upload_btn.upload(upload_json, upload_btn, [upload_status, category])
|
| 177 |
+
|
| 178 |
+
# Fixed downloads using click with component inputs
|
| 179 |
+
download_json_btn.click(lambda: download_current_json(), inputs=None, outputs=download_json_btn)
|
| 180 |
+
download_csv_btn.click(lambda history: download_conversation_csv(history), inputs=chatbot, outputs=download_csv_btn)
|
| 181 |
|
| 182 |
# -----------------------------
|
| 183 |
# Startup log
|